Comparing Nutrient Loss in Centrifugal vs. Slow Juicers

Centrifugal juicers operate at high speeds, which can be a double-edged sword. While they quickly extract juice from fruits and vegetables, the rapid spinning generates heat. This heat can lead to significant nutrient loss, particularly sensitive vitamins like vitamin C and specific B vitamins. In contrast, slow juicers utilise a low-speed extraction method. This gentle process minimises heat production and oxidation, preserving essential nutrients more effectively. The result is juice that not only tastes fresher but also retains a higher concentration of beneficial compounds.

When comparing these two types of juicers, it becomes clear that speed comes at a cost. Those seeking maximum health benefits often turn to slow juicing for its superior ability to maintain nutrient integrity and overall juice quality.

Long-Term Storage Tips to Maintain Nutritional Value

To ensure juice retains its nutritional value over time, proper storage is essential. Freshly extracted juice is at its peak immediately after juicing, but with the appropriate practices, it can maintain much of its quality even when stored. Using airtight containers can significantly reduce exposure to air and minimise oxidation. Glass jars are often recommended because they do not leach chemicals, unlike some plastics. Filling these containers to the brim limits the oxygen inside, further protecting nutrients.

Refrigeration plays a critical role in extending shelf life. Keeping juices cold slows down enzymatic activity and bacterial growth. Fresh juice should be consumed within 24 to 48 hours for optimal nutrient retention.

For those looking to store juice longer, freezing is an effective option. However, it's essential to leave some space in the container since liquids expand when frozen. Keep in mind that while freezing does preserve many vitamins and minerals well, there may still be slight losses compared to fresh consumption.

 Additionally, avoiding exposure to light is crucial; UV rays can degrade specific vitamins quickly. A dark fridge or opaque containers help combat this issue effectively.
